.TH "sefcontext_compile" "8" "12 Aug 2015" "dwalsh@redhat.com" "SELinux Command Line documentation"
.SH "NAME"
sefcontext_compile \- compile file context regular expression files
.
.SH "SYNOPSIS"
.B sefcontext_compile
.RB [ \-o
.IR outputfile ]
.RB [ \-p
.IR policyfile ]
.I inputfile
.
.SH "DESCRIPTION"
.B sefcontext_compile
is used to compile file context regular expressions into
.BR pcre (3)
format.
.sp
The compiled file is used by libselinux file labeling functions.
.sp
By default
.B sefcontext_compile
writes the compiled pcre file with the
.B .bin
suffix appended (e.g. \fIinputfile\fB.bin\fR).
.SH OPTIONS
.TP
.B \-o
Specify an
.I outputfile
that must be a fully qualified file name as the
.B .bin
suffix is not automatically added.
.TP
.B \-p
Specify a binary
.I policyfile
that will be used to validate the context entries in the
.I inputfile
.br
If an invalid context is found the pcre formatted file will not be written and
an error will be returned.
.SH "RETURN VALUE"
On error -1 is returned. On success 0 is returned.
.SH "EXAMPLES"
.B Example 1:
.br
sefcontext_compile /etc/selinux/targeted/contexts/files/file_contexts
.sp
Results in the following file being generated:
.RS
/etc/selinux/targeted/contexts/files/file_contexts.bin
.RE
.sp
.B Example 2:
.br
sefcontext_compile -o new_fc.bin /etc/selinux/targeted/contexts/files/file_contexts
.sp
Results in the following file being generated in the cwd:
.RS
new_fc.bin
.RE
